Crypto IPO Frenzy: Gemini Eyes Public Debut as Market Sentiment Shifts
Crypto markets are abuzz as the leading exchange Gemini Trust Co. confidentially files for an initial public offering, signaling renewed optimism amid shifting regulatory headwinds. The crypto IPO landscape is evolving rapidly, and Gemini’s move highlights the sector’s return to Wall Street’s spotlight.
This latest crypto development follows Gemini’s navigation through significant regulatory barriers. Earlier this year, a U.S. regulatory agency dropped its investigation into Gemini with no recommended enforcement—effectively removing a major stumbling block for the firm. Additionally, Gemini settled a $5 million case with a top derivatives regulator in January, further smoothing its path to a public listing.
Gemini’s IPO play book mirrors a growing trend in digital asset companies going public. Just this week, the stablecoin issuer Circle enjoyed a blockbuster debut with shares soaring on opening days. Similarly, Galaxy Digital, another crypto giant, recently transitioned its listing to a major U.S. stock exchange, further legitimizing crypto as an institutional asset class. While details regarding Gemini’s IPO pricing and structure remain under wraps, the company’s confidential filing strategy allows it to quietly gauge investor appetite while delaying public financial disclosures. This approach is increasingly favored among disruptive fintech and blockchain firms.
Gemini stated their listing will proceed after federal approval and market review, emphasizing flexibility—which is crucial given the recent volatility in both crypto and equity markets. According to industry experts, the decision to file now takes advantage of a more favorable environment as regulators show openness toward blockchain technologies and digital asset innovation.
